数字化转型已成为企业发展的必然趋势。传统的软件开发模式周期长、成本高、门槛高,严重制约了企业数字化进程。此时,低代码作为一种全新的软件开发模式,应运而生,为企业的数字化转型提供了新的解决方案。本文将从低代码的定义、优势、应用领域以及面临的挑战等方面进行探讨。

一、低代码的定义

低代码(Low-Code)是一种新兴的软件开发模式,它通过可视化的编程界面和组件化的开发方式,让非专业开发者能够快速构建应用程序。低代码平台通常提供丰富的模板、组件和工具,降低开发难度,缩短开发周期,降低开发成本。

二、低代码的优势

低代码重构未来,引领企业数字化变革

1. 降低开发门槛:低代码平台将复杂的编程逻辑封装在组件中,开发者只需拖拽、配置即可实现应用开发,无需深入了解编程语言和框架。

2. 提高开发效率:低代码平台提供丰富的模板和组件,开发者可以快速搭建应用框架,缩短开发周期,降低开发成本。

3. 适应性强:低代码平台支持多种开发环境,如Web、移动、桌面等,满足不同场景下的应用需求。

4. 易于维护:低代码平台的应用程序结构清晰,便于后期维护和升级。

5. 降低企业风险:低代码平台具有较高的安全性,能有效降低企业应用开发过程中的风险。

三、低代码的应用领域

1. 企业内部应用:如人事管理系统、财务管理系统、项目管理系统等。

2. 移动应用开发:如企业内部移动办公、客户关系管理等。

3. 物联网应用:如智能家居、智能穿戴设备等。

4. 数据可视化:如数据分析、报表生成等。

5. 电商平台:如电商平台、在线商城等。

四、低代码面临的挑战

1. 技术成熟度:虽然低代码技术发展迅速,但仍存在一些技术瓶颈,如性能、稳定性等。

2. 生态建设:低代码平台的生态建设尚不完善,缺乏成熟的组件和工具。

3. 人才缺口:低代码技术人才相对较少,企业面临人才短缺的问题。

4. 安全性:低代码平台的安全性仍需提高,以应对潜在的安全威胁。

低代码作为一种新兴的软件开发模式,为企业的数字化转型提供了新的解决方案。低代码技术仍处于发展阶段,企业应关注技术成熟度、生态建设、人才缺口和安全性等问题,以充分发挥低代码的优势,推动企业数字化进程。

引用权威资料:

1. Gartner报告:《Gartner: Low-Code Application Platforms Will Be a $15.8 Billion Market by 2025》,2020年。

2. IDC报告:《IDC:2020年低代码平台市场分析》,2020年。

3. Forrester报告:《Forrester:低代码平台市场概览》,2019年。

低代码技术为企业数字化转型带来了新的机遇,但同时也面临诸多挑战。企业应把握发展趋势,积极拥抱低代码技术,以实现数字化转型升级。